Output e475deb700315088f360275c3a7172d4ced27a9bf90b1c5675d531d8bff63240:33

value
104168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66bf39be3a99ac25b92afcd55d67b5154332e27f OP_EQUAL
address
3B4HvhGyJ5W4xeGXFo6Adjfrvq3iD6B9ys
transaction
e475deb700315088f360275c3a7172d4ced27a9bf90b1c5675d531d8bff63240
spent
true